Thibaut Nicolas Marc Courtois (born 11 May 1992) is a Belgian professional footballer who plays as a goalkeeper for Real Madrid. He is widely considered the best goalkeeper in the world when fit. Standing at 2 meters tall, he combines immense reach with elite reflexes. His performance in the 2022 Champions League Final against Liverpool (making 9 saves) is regarded as the greatest goalkeeping performance in a European final ever. Courtois missed most of the 2023-24 season with an ACL injury but returned just in time to win the 2024 Champions League final, proving his elite mentality. In 2024, he publicly quit the Belgium national team due to a rift with coach Domenico Tedesco over the captaincy, stating he would not return while Tedesco was in charge.
